Empirical Evaluation of Computer-Adaptive Alternate Short Forms for the Assessment of Anomia Severity

PURPOSE: The purpose of this study was to verify the equivalence of 2 alternate test forms with nonoverlapping content generated by an item response theory (IRT)–based computer-adaptive test (CAT).
